Serialized Form
-
Package com.sysdig.jenkins.plugins.sysdig.domain
-
Package com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.AcceptedRisk
class AcceptedRisk extends Object implements Serializable-
Serialized Fields
-
assignedToPackages
Set<Package> assignedToPackages
-
assignedToVulnerabilities
Set<Vulnerability> assignedToVulnerabilities
-
createdAt
Date createdAt
-
description
String description
-
expirationDate
Date expirationDate
-
id
String id
-
isActive
boolean isActive
-
reason
AcceptedRiskReason reason
-
root
ScanResult root
-
updatedAt
Date updatedAt
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.Layer
class Layer extends Object implements Serializable-
Serialized Fields
-
command
String command
-
digest
String digest
-
packages
Set<Package> packages
-
root
ScanResult root
-
size
BigInteger size
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.Metadata
class Metadata extends Object implements Serializable-
Serialized Fields
-
architecture
Architecture architecture
-
baseOS
OperatingSystem baseOS
-
createdAt
Date createdAt
-
digest
String digest
-
imageID
String imageID
-
labels
Map<String,
String> labels -
pullString
String pullString
-
root
ScanResult root
-
sizeInBytes
BigInteger sizeInBytes
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.OperatingSystem
class OperatingSystem extends Object implements Serializable-
Serialized Fields
-
family
OperatingSystem.Family family
-
name
String name
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.Package
class Package extends Object implements Serializable-
Serialized Fields
-
acceptedRisks
Set<AcceptedRisk> acceptedRisks
-
foundInLayer
Layer foundInLayer
-
name
String name
-
path
String path
-
root
ScanResult root
-
type
PackageType type
-
version
String version
-
vulnerabilities
Set<Vulnerability> vulnerabilities
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.Policy
class Policy extends Object implements Serializable-
Serialized Fields
-
bundles
Set<PolicyBundle> bundles
-
createdAt
Date createdAt
-
id
String id
-
name
String name
-
root
ScanResult root
-
updatedAt
Date updatedAt
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.PolicyBundle
class PolicyBundle extends Object implements Serializable-
Serialized Fields
-
foundInPolicies
Set<Policy> foundInPolicies
-
id
String id
-
name
String name
-
root
ScanResult root
-
rules
LinkedHashSet<PolicyBundleRule> rules
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.PolicyBundleRule
class PolicyBundleRule extends Object implements Serializable-
Serialized Fields
-
description
String description
-
evaluationResult
EvaluationResult evaluationResult
-
failures
List<PolicyBundleRuleFailure> failures
-
id
String id
-
parent
PolicyBundle parent
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.PolicyBundleRuleImageConfigFailure
class PolicyBundleRuleImageConfigFailure extends Object implements Serializable-
Serialized Fields
-
description
String description
-
parent
PolicyBundleRule parent
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.PolicyBundleRulePkgVulnFailure
class PolicyBundleRulePkgVulnFailure extends Object implements Serializable-
Serialized Fields
-
parent
PolicyBundleRule parent
-
remediation
String remediation
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.ScanResult
class ScanResult extends Object implements Serializable-
Serialized Fields
-
acceptedRisks
Map<String,
AcceptedRisk> acceptedRisks -
layers
Map<String,
Layer> layers -
metadata
Metadata metadata
-
packages
Map<Package,
Package> packages -
policies
Map<String,
Policy> policies -
policyBundles
Map<String,
PolicyBundle> policyBundles -
type
ScanType type
-
vulnerabilities
Map<String,
Vulnerability> vulnerabilities
-
-
-
Class com.sysdig.jenkins.plugins.sysdig.domain.vm.scanresult.Vulnerability
class Vulnerability extends Object implements Serializable-
Serialized Fields
-
acceptedRisks
Set<AcceptedRisk> acceptedRisks
-
cve
String cve
-
disclosureDate
Date disclosureDate
-
exploitable
boolean exploitable
-
fixVersion
String fixVersion
-
foundInPackages
Set<Package> foundInPackages
-
root
ScanResult root
-
severity
Severity severity
-
solutionDate
Date solutionDate
-
-
-
-
Package com.sysdig.jenkins.plugins.sysdig.infrastructure.jenkins.iac.entrypoint
-
Exception com.sysdig.jenkins.plugins.sysdig.infrastructure.jenkins.iac.entrypoint.IaCScanningBuilder.BadParamCLIScan
class BadParamCLIScan extends Exception implements Serializable -
Exception com.sysdig.jenkins.plugins.sysdig.infrastructure.jenkins.iac.entrypoint.IaCScanningBuilder.FailedCLIScan
class FailedCLIScan extends Exception implements Serializable
-
-
Package com.sysdig.jenkins.plugins.sysdig.infrastructure.jenkins.vm
-
Class com.sysdig.jenkins.plugins.sysdig.infrastructure.jenkins.vm.ImageImageScanningConfig
class ImageImageScanningConfig extends Object implements Serializable-
Serialized Fields
-
bailOnFail
boolean bailOnFail
-
bailOnPluginFail
boolean bailOnPluginFail
-
cliVersionToApply
String cliVersionToApply
-
customCliVersion
String customCliVersion
-
engineurl
String engineurl
-
engineverify
boolean engineverify
-
imageName
String imageName
-
inlineScanExtraParams
String inlineScanExtraParams
-
policiesToApply
String policiesToApply
-
scannerBinaryPath
String scannerBinaryPath
-
sysdigToken
String sysdigToken
-
-
-
-
Package com.sysdig.jenkins.plugins.sysdig.infrastructure.log
-
Class com.sysdig.jenkins.plugins.sysdig.infrastructure.log.ConsoleLog
class ConsoleLog extends Object implements Serializable- serialVersionUID:
- 1L
-
Serialized Fields
-
enableDebug
boolean enableDebug
-
listener
TaskListener listener
-
name
String name
-
-
Class com.sysdig.jenkins.plugins.sysdig.infrastructure.log.NopLogger
class NopLogger extends Object implements Serializable
-